Output 66c80e256d0cf6ee06e21ff4a1f60e3d77dff3f2c2b805679632362732ac4d63:1

value
44238557
script pubkey
OP_0 OP_PUSHBYTES_20 94a4884d1f45cc1154f1d0a61a52a599d8c1b938
address
bc1qjjjgsnglghxpz4836znp5549n8vvrwfcrr30xy
transaction
66c80e256d0cf6ee06e21ff4a1f60e3d77dff3f2c2b805679632362732ac4d63